RICHMOND COUNTY DISTRICT ATTORNEY

The men and women of the Richmond County District Attorney’s office work each day in partnership with Law Enforcement and the people of Staten Island to pursue justice for victims of crime, to prevent crime in all its forms, and to promote the safety and well‑being of all citizens of our Borough.

THE BUREAU

This is a support staff role within the Administration Bureau. The Administration Bureau is made up of six units: Finance, Procurement, Human Capital, Information Technology, Facilities and Special Projects and Initiatives (SPI). The Administration Bureau serves as a customer service resource for the agency. As part of the Facilities team the selected candidate will serve as a Facilities Assistant; this team is responsible for managing daily ad‑hoc requests and maintenance of all RCDA facilities in support of our employees carrying out the agency’s mission.

THE ROLE
  • Deliver time sensitive and confidential documents throughout the 5 boroughs to various City and private agencies using agency vehicle and/or public transportation.
  • Respond to help desk ticket request for a range of issues related to for maintenance of all RCDA facilities.
  • Participate in facilities maintenance projects such as painting, signage maintenance, and furniture deliveries.
  • Assist with keeping RCDA facilities secure by producing employee and intern ID badges and keys as well as monitoring security cameras.
  • Inter office deliveries between floors and building of court documents and supplies for daily court/ office functions.
  • Liaise with various agencies including DCAS Engineers; serve as a representative of the RCDA to correct any building issues identified.
  • Updating and Maintaining Fleet database and management system.
  • Gather reports for Director of Facilities on Fleet maintenance.
  • Other duties as assigned by Chief of Administration or Supervisor of Facilities.

Schedule: The selected candidate may be required to work overtime which may include weekends and holidays.

Public Service Loan Forgiveness

As a prospective employee of the City of New York, you may be eligible for federal loan forgiveness programs and state repayment assistance programs. For more information, please visit the U.S. Department of Education’s website at https://studentaid.gov/pslf/.

Residency Requirement

New York City residency is generally required within 90 days of appointment. However, City Employees in certain titles who have worked for the City for 2 continuous years may also be eligible to reside in Nassau, Suffolk, Putnam, Westchester, Rockland, or Orange County. To determine if the residency requirement applies to you, please discuss with the agency representative at the time of interview.
